    Notes: The 13C NMR characteristics of the polyaminocarboxylate ligands EDTA [(HO2CCH2)2NCH2CH2N(CH2CO2H)2],DTPA (HO2CCH2)2NCH2CH2N(CH2CO2H)CH2CH2N(CH2CO2H)2 and NTA [N(CH2CO2H)3] and their Tl(III) complexes are reported. The pH dependence of the 13C shifts of the ligands is helpful in understanding the 13C coordination chemical shifts, Δδ, but not the thallium-carbon coupling constants J(205TI, 13C), which vary markedly for no apparent reason. The anion Tl(DTPA-5H)2- contains three non-equivalent coordinated carboxyl functions and a suggestion is made to account for this lower symmetry.
